Brunswick Terrace Pavement repaired

Brunswick Terrace’s pavement has finally been resurfaced after 10 months of lobbying by Cllr Sarah Whitebread and local residents. The pavement has now been flattened and is in a much better condition.

Sarah said, “It shouldn’t take this long for the Tory-run County Council to fix. The County’s new budget cuts funding for such repairs even more. These sort of small jobs should be sorted out in a matter of weeks.”

City Council steps in for disabled people

After inaction by the Tory-run County Council, Lib Dems have stepped in and installed three new mobility crossings in the city centre.

The new crossings are on Trumpington Street, Tennis Court Road and Jesus Lane.

“These were among the key sites where wheelchair users said they were struggling,” said Cllr Tim Bick, who campaigned for this.

“There are many more needed in the medieval streets of the city centre, but much more progress could be made if the County recognised their responsibility and didn’t just leave it to the City.”
